Strained Cyclic Alkyl(amino)carbene-Stabilized Tetraatomic Silicon(0) Cluster

Lewis-base-stabilized silicon species in the zero oxidation state are crucial for transforming elemental silicon into valuable compounds. The synthesis of a cyclic tetraatomic silicon(0) cluster, stabilized by four-membered cyclic alkyl(amino) carbenes, is reported. It is a versatile one, two, or four silicon atom source, demonstrating cluster isomerization or fragmentation.
